A member of the Iowa State University Football team is holding an event in the City of Perry in July.

ISU Freshman Quarterback Rocco Becht is hosting a football camp at Perry High School on July 13th. According to a press release, the camp will be open to kids in grades fifth through eighth and will be free. The release states that Becht will use his NIL (name, image, and likeness) funds in order to make the camp available for students in the Perry community.
